Understanding Bad Debt Scenarios in Nairobi's Commercial Hub
Businesses in Nairobi CBD frequently encounter bad debt, arising from unpaid invoices, unfulfilled contracts, or defaulted loan agreements. The legal framework governing such situations in Kenya is robust, encompassing statutes like the Contracts Act (Cap 4) and the Limitation of Actions Act (Cap 22), which dictates the timeframe within which legal action can be initiated. Understanding the distinction between actionable debt and irrecoverable sums, and the documentation required, such as proof of service rendered or goods delivered, is critical. Navigating the requirements of the Civil Procedure Act (Cap 21) for filing claims is essential, and our advocates are well-versed in these critical legal parameters that define successful debt recovery efforts within Nairobi.

Strategic Approaches to Bad Debt Recovery in Nairobi CBD
Effective recovery of bad debt in Nairobi CBD involves a strategic, multi-pronged approach. It often begins with a strong demand letter, clearly outlining the debt, payment terms, and potential legal repercussions. If this proves unsuccessful, legal proceedings may be initiated in the appropriate Kenyan court, such as the Magistrates Court or the High Court, depending on the claim's value. We also leverage alternative dispute resolution (ADR) mechanisms, including mediation, to achieve swift and cost-effective resolutions outside of protracted litigation. Our team ensures all procedural requirements under the Civil Procedure Rules are meticulously followed, from proper service of summons to evidence presentation, maximizing the chances of a successful recovery for your business.

Consultation Fees for Bad Debt Legal Advice in Nairobi CBD

The cost of obtaining legal advice for bad debt in Nairobi CBD typically involves initial consultation fees, which can range from KES 5,000 to KES 15,000, depending on the complexity discussed. Should you engage Mwenda Njagi & Co. Advocates for debt recovery, our fee structure is transparent and will be clearly outlined. This may include hourly rates, estimated costs for specific legal actions like drafting demand letters (e.g., KES 10,000-25,000) or filing a suit (which includes court fees and our professional charges, potentially ranging from KES 30,000 upwards).
